### Introduction Condition monitoring of electrical machinery is a proactive maintenance strategy that involves the regular measurement and analysis of key operational parameters. The goal is to detect the early onset of degradation or failure, allowing for planned, corrective maintenance before a catastrophic breakdown occurs.
